Understanding the DJI Mavic 3 Pro Cine
The DJI Mavic 3 Pro Cine is a professional-grade drone equipped with a Hasselblad camera, offering 5.1K video recording and a 20MP still image capability. Its advanced obstacle avoidance, extended flight time, and intelligent flight modes make it suitable for various commercial uses such as aerial photography, videography, surveying, and inspection.
Cost Analysis
The retail price of the DJI Mavic 3 Pro Cine is approximately $4,999. This includes the drone, remote controller, and necessary accessories. Additional costs may include spare batteries, storage solutions, and software subscriptions for post-processing. When calculating ROI, it’s essential to consider these initial investments along with ongoing operational costs.

Calculating ROI
ROI is determined by comparing the benefits gained from the drone to its total cost. For businesses, this includes increased revenue, cost savings, and efficiency improvements. The basic formula is:
ROI = (Net Benefits / Total Investment) x 100%
Estimating Benefits
For example, a real estate company might close more deals with high-quality aerial shots, resulting in increased sales. Construction firms can reduce inspection time and improve safety compliance. Quantifying these benefits involves estimating additional revenue or cost savings attributable to drone use over a specific period.
Assessing Costs
Costs include the purchase price, maintenance, training, and operational expenses. For accurate ROI calculations, these should be summed over the expected lifespan of the drone.
